ACI determines the bulk volume of coarse aggregate per unit volume of concrete based on the nominal maximum size of the aggregate and the fineness modulus of the fine aggregate (sand).

This is a key step where the ACI method excels. The sheet uses a lookup table to determine the volume of dry-rodded coarse aggregate per unit volume of concrete, based on the NMAS and the fineness modulus of the sand. This value is then used to calculate the weight of coarse aggregate needed.

Many professional sheets allow blending of up to six aggregates (to meet a target combined grading), up to four cementitious materials (cement + fly ash + slag + silica fume) and several admixtures . This is essential for modern low‑carbon and high‑performance mixes.

Aggregates in the field are rarely perfectly dry. An advanced Excel sheet will allow the user to input the aggregates' moisture content and absorption capacity. It will then automatically adjust the batch weights to account for the water already present in or needed by the aggregates, while also adjusting the total mixing water accordingly.
